Frequently asked questions

What is the name of Awa's airport?
Awa is served by multiple airports, but most people use Takamatsu Airport (TAK).
How far is Takamatsu Airport (TAK) from central Awa?
The trip from Takamatsu Airport to downtown Awa is reasonably long. You'll have to travel 27 kilometres before you can check in to your city hotel.
What airport is best to fly into Awa?
If you're planning on hopping on a flight to Awa, you'll probably touchdown at TAK (27 kilometres from downtown). Tokushima Airport (29 kilometres from downtown) is the other major airport that services the city.
How many airlines fly to Awa?
There are 11 air carriers that fly into Awa from 9 airports across the globe.
Which airlines fly to Awa?
Japan Airlines and ANA offer the most flights to Awa. One of the most popular ways to travel there is on a Japan Airlines flight from Tokyo.
How many nonstop flights are there to Awa?
Planning an awesome Awa getaway is child's play when there are 236 nonstop flights each week to select from.
Where are the most popular flights to Awa departing from?
Travellers frequently set off from Tokyo, Seoul and Fukuoka airports when heading to Awa.
How long is the flight to Awa Airport?
If it's Tokyo you're departing, you'll be midair for around 1 hour and 27 minutes before you touchdown in Awa. Runway to runway from Seoul takes approximately 1 hour and 39 minutes and from Fukuoka, the average flight time is 1 hour and 2 minutes.

How to get through airport security fast when flying to Awa?
The trick is to be well organised before you get to the airport security gate. That way, you'll be stepping onto that plane to Awa before you know it. Follow these tips and get your trip off to a great start:

  • Be sure to have your passport and travel documents easily accessible. They'll be the first things you'll be asked to show at security.
  • Next up, both you and your carry-on bag must be X-rayed. To speed things up, take off anything that is likely to trigger the alarm. Personal belongings such as your belt, coat and headphones will be required to go through the machine.
  • For just a few moments, you'll have to unplug from technology. Your tablet, phone and any other electronics also need to go through the scanner.
  • Any liquids or gels, such as perfume or hand cream, that you want to bring on board must be no larger than 3.4 ounces (100 millilitres). Also, everything must fit inside a quart-size (one litre), zip-lock bag.
  • Choosing your footwear wisely can save you several valuable minutes. Boots and bulky shoes are often required to be removed and separately scanned. Lightweight sneakers are usually not.
  • Sharp items like knives are not allowed in the cabin. They'll be seized at security, so put them in your checked luggage.
